James Nolan was born in 1918 in Yonkers, New York, the child of William Joseph Nolan And Emmaline Van Wart. In 1920, James Nolan resided in Yonkers Ward 2, Westchester, New York, USA. In 1930, James Nolan resided in Bethel, Fairfield, Connecticut, USA. James Nolan married Grace R Nolan. James Nolan passed away in 1996 in Danbury, Fairfield, Connecticut, USA.
